/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Discovering the World of Casinos Not Signed Up With

Discovering the World of Casinos Not Signed Up With

Discovering the World of Casinos Not Signed Up With

Unveiling the World of Casinos Not Signed Up With

When it comes to the exhilarating domain of online gambling, most players are familiar with the major players in the industry. Yet, there exists a fascinating realm of casinos not signed up with GamStop Barry Tourist Railway these mainstream giants, which can offer unique experiences and unexpected rewards for those willing to explore outside the conventional paths. This article delves into the benefits, risks, and some excellent choices in this less-trodden path of online gambling.

The Appeal of Independent Casinos

Independent casinos or those not signed up with large networks often attract players because of their personalized offerings and unique gameplay experiences. Unlike bigger establishments, these casinos often prioritize customer satisfaction by offering incentives and bonuses that can significantly enhance the player’s experience.

Unique Bonuses and Promotions

One of the greatest advantages of opting for independent casinos is the variety of bonuses and promotions they provide. These casinos understand the importance of attracting new players and retaining existing ones. Therefore, they tend to offer larger welcome bonuses, free spins, and loyalty rewards that surpass those found at conventional casinos. This can lead to enhanced gameplay and improved odds of winning.

Specialized Games

Discovering the World of Casinos Not Signed Up With

Many casinos not signed up with large networks focus on niche markets or specific game types. For instance, a lesser-known casino might specialize in particular slot game themes or provide exclusive table games like unique variations of poker and blackjack not found elsewhere. Players who have specific interests may find that these specialized platforms cater more closely to their tastes.

Greater Flexibility in Payment Methods

Independent casinos often embrace a wider array of payment methods, accommodating players from various regions. For instance, while mainstream casinos may only support established banking options, smaller establishments might allow cryptocurrencies, e-wallets, or even regional payment solutions. This can simplify the process of deposits and withdrawals, making transactions smoother and more convenient.

Risks of Playing at Lesser-Known Casinos

While there are many advantages to playing at casinos not signed up with larger networks, there are also inherent risks. It’s crucial for players to conduct thorough research before committing to a new gaming site.

Lack of Regulation

One major concern with independent casinos is the variance in regulations and licenses. Some may operate without proper licensing or oversight, potentially leading to unfair practices. It is paramount for players to check if the casino is licensed by reputable gaming authorities to ensure a safe experience.

Customer Support Challenges

Discovering the World of Casinos Not Signed Up With

Customer support can be hit or miss at independent casinos. Larger networks often have dedicated customer service teams available around the clock, while smaller casinos may not offer the same level of support. It’s a good idea for players to assess the support offered by a casino before signing up, looking for options like live chat, email, and phone support.

Fewer Reviews and Recommendations

Due to their lower profile, these casinos may not have extensive reviews or player feedback compared to their mainstream counterparts. This can make it more challenging for potential players to gauge the quality and reliability of a casino. Engaging with gambling forums and communities can provide insight and shared experiences from players who have tried these platforms.

Finding Reliable Casinos

To discover reputable casinos not signed up with larger networks, players should consider the following tips:

  • Check Licensing: Ensure that the casino holds a valid gaming license from a recognized authority.
  • Research the Casino: Look for online reviews, player testimonials, and discussions on gambling forums.
  • Assess Game Variety: Explore the range of games offered to see if they suit your interests.
  • Contact Customer Support: Reach out with questions before signing up to gauge their responsiveness.
  • Examine Payment Options: Ensure the casino offers convenient and secure payment methods.

Conclusion

Casinos not signed up with major gambling platforms represent a hidden gem in the world of online gaming. By venturing beyond the familiar, players can uncover exciting opportunities, tailor-made gaming experiences, and enticing promotions that larger casinos may overlook. However, with this opportunity comes responsibility; due diligence should always be performed to ensure a secure and enjoyable gaming experience. With careful consideration, players can enjoy the thrills of independent casinos while reaping the benefits that come with exploring this exciting and diverse sector of online gambling.